Enable job alerts via email!

Sys Dev Engineer - Infrastructure, Annapurna Labs

Amazon Web Services (AWS)

Austin (TX)

On-site

USD 99,000 - 129,000

Full time

13 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Join a cutting-edge team at a leading tech company, where you'll innovate in cloud computing infrastructure. As a Sys Dev Engineer, you'll work alongside top engineers to develop advanced machine learning accelerators. This role offers the chance to impact the future of cloud technology, working in a dynamic environment that values creativity and collaboration. If you're passionate about building infrastructure that powers the next generation of cloud services, this opportunity is perfect for you. Be part of a team that is transforming the industry and delighting customers worldwide.

Qualifications

  • 2+ years of software development experience.
  • Hands-on systems engineering experience in networking and storage.
  • Experience with modern programming languages.

Responsibilities

  • Build Cloud-Scale Machine Learning Acceleration Infrastructure.
  • Develop and execute infrastructure development plans.
  • Identify and implement process improvements.

Skills

Software Development
Networking
Systems Engineering
Cloud Solutions
Automation
Programming (Python, Java, C++)

Education

Bachelor's Degree in Computer Science

Tools

AWS
Linux/Unix
CI/CD Pipelines

Job description

Join to apply for the Sys Dev Engineer - Infrastructure, Annapurna Labs role at Amazon Web Services (AWS)

1 week ago Be among the first 25 applicants

Join to apply for the Sys Dev Engineer - Infrastructure, Annapurna Labs role at Amazon Web Services (AWS)

Description

Annapurna Labs, our organization within AWS, is responsible for building innovation in silicon and software for AWS customers. With development centers in the U.S. and Israel, Annapurna is at the forefront of innovation by combining cloud scale with the world’s most talented engineers. The Annapurna team covers multiple disciplines including silicon engineering, hardware design and verification, software, and operations. Because of Annapurna's breadth of talent, we’ve been able to improve AWS cloud infrastructure in networking and security with products such as AWS Nitro, Enhanced Network Adapter (ENA), and Elastic Fabric Adapter (EFA), in compute with AWS Graviton and F2 EC2 Instances, in machine learning with AWS Neuron, Inferentia and Trainium ML Accelerators, and in storage with scalable NVMe.

Description

Annapurna Labs, our organization within AWS, is responsible for building innovation in silicon and software for AWS customers. With development centers in the U.S. and Israel, Annapurna is at the forefront of innovation by combining cloud scale with the world’s most talented engineers. The Annapurna team covers multiple disciplines including silicon engineering, hardware design and verification, software, and operations. Because of Annapurna's breadth of talent, we’ve been able to improve AWS cloud infrastructure in networking and security with products such as AWS Nitro, Enhanced Network Adapter (ENA), and Elastic Fabric Adapter (EFA), in compute with AWS Graviton and F2 EC2 Instances, in machine learning with AWS Neuron, Inferentia and Trainium ML Accelerators, and in storage with scalable NVMe.

As part of Annapurna Labs Infrastructure team, you’ll have the opportunity to invent the next generation of cloud computing infrastructure. You’ll experience what it’s like to work in a fast-paced, innovative, and start-up like environment filled with some of the brightest minds in the industry. The work we do is at massive scale and deeply important to our customers. The infrastructure is used by Annapurna engineers to design and build every component of our hardware and software to come together into products that our customers use for accelerated computing.

If you want a career that makes an impact, allows you to invent, and have first-hand visibility into how your implementations delight customers, then we have a role for you.

If you're interested in being on a team that is "building a complete product" from inception to delighted customers, Annapurna is a fantastic choice.

Join us in creating the most advanced Machine Learning Accelerators in the world!

Key job responsibilities

As a systems development engineer you will build Cloud-Scale Machine Learning Acceleration Infrastructure including architecting and delivering directly to your customers, the Annapurna engineering teams, that are building hardware/software running in our data centers which are custom designed machine learning products: AWS Inferentia2 and Trainium.

You will interact with multiple teams to develop and execute in-depth infrastructure development plans and dive deep to solve critical infrastructure issues involving networking, high performance compute clusters, infrastructure automation of hardware/software/firmware testing, and ASIC/EDA development. You will execute and scale the next generation of cloud infrastructure based on cloud frameworks and AWS services. You will own design reviews for infrastructure development and partner with AWS service teams and vendors. You will influence within your team, your customers and AWS service teams to help drive and develop the technical implementation for overall system designs. You will identify and implement process improvements which improve the team’s agility and operations, including improvements to design, automation, development, test or operations. You will define new mechanisms that execute system health monitoring, diagnostics, repair, and automation. You will develop, document and update operational runbooks as you participate in on-call rotations.

A day in the life

Each Day You Will Work With The Best Engineers In The Industry To Develop Machine Learning Accelerators. On-site In Austin, Texas, You Will Be Apart Of The Team That Develops Custom Silicon And You Will Own The Infrastructure That Enables This Innovation. Take a Look Inside Our Labs To See What You Will Learn At Annapurna Labs

https://www.aboutamazon.com/news/aws/take-a-look-inside-the-lab-where-aws-makes-custom-chips

https://youtu.be/rViVFrQg4Hk

Basic Qualifications

  • 2+ years of non-internship professional software development experience
  • 1+ years of designing or architecting (design patterns, reliability and scaling) of new and existing systems experience
  • 3+ years of administrative experience in networking, storage systems, operating systems and hands-on systems engineering experience
  • Knowledge of systems engineering fundamentals (networking, storage, operating systems)
  • Experience programming with at least one modern language such as C++, C#, Java, Python, Golang, PowerShell, Ruby
  • Bachelor's degree in computer science or equivalent

Preferred Qualifications

  • Experience programming with at least one modern language such as Python, Ruby, Golang, Java, C++, C#, Rust
  • Experience utilizing AWS cloud solutions in a DevOps environment
  • Experience with Linux/Unix
  • Experience in automating, deploying, and supporting large-scale infrastructure
  • Experience building services using AWS products
  • Experience with CI/CD pipelines build processes

Amazon is an equal opportunity employer and does not discriminate on the basis of protected veteran status, disability, or other legally protected status.

Our inclusive culture empowers Amazonians to deliver the best results for our customers. If you have a disability and need a workplace accommodation or adjustment during the application and hiring process, including support for the interview or onboarding process, please visit https://amazon.jobs/content/en/how-we-hire/accommodations for more information. If the country/region you’re applying in isn’t listed, please contact your Recruiting Partner.

Company - Annapurna Labs (U.S.) Inc.

Job ID: A2965322

Seniority level
  • Not Applicable
Employment type
  • Full-time
Job function
  • Manufacturing and Engineering
  • IT Services and IT Consulting

Referrals increase your chances of interviewing at Amazon Web Services (AWS) by 2x

Sign in to set job alerts for “Development Engineer” roles.
Engineering & Product - Interested in future opportunities?

Austin, Texas Metropolitan Area 10 months ago

Austin, Texas Metropolitan Area $99,461.00-$128,329.00 10 hours ago

Product Design Engineer, In House Cell Engineering
Process Development and Scale Up Engineer

Austin, Texas Metropolitan Area $100,000.00-$150,000.00 5 hours ago

Simulation Engineer, Innovation and Design Engineering

Austin, TX $125,000.00-$200,000.00 5 months ago

Mechanical Design Automation Engineer, Cathode

We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.